The Korpi (“Deep Woods”) has a blade that is a bit shorter and narrower, and would be a good knife for carving, whittling, or scrimshaw. The handle is longer for control but is a bit narrower so is better suited for average-sized hands.
Below are the detailed measurements of this knife. One important note: for best comfort and grip, the length of your middle finger should be similar to the circumference of the handle.
- Blade Material: 0.8% high carbon steel, hardened to 59 Rockwell
- Knife Length: 7.5 inches (19 cm)
- Blade Length: 3 inches (7.6 cm)
- Blade Width: 0.75 inches (1.9 cm)
- Blade Thickness: 0.12 inches (3 mm)
- Knife Weight: 2.9 ounces (82 grams)
- Handle Length: 4.25 inches (10.8 cm)
- Pommel: tang end with brass nut
- Handle Circumference: 3.5 inches (8.9 cm)
- Handle Material: stained curly birch
- Sheathed Weight: 4.2 ounces (119 grams)
- Sheathed Length: 8.5 inches (21.6 cm)
- Belt Loop Width: 2.5 inches (6.4 cm)
